Dhivehi[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Borrowed from Sanskrit शत (śata) + एक (eka); the expected Dhivehi development of Sanskrit शत (śata) would be *ހިޔަ (*hiya) (compare obsolete dialectal ހިއަ (hia)). Doublet of ހިޔަ (hiya).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/s̺əteːkə/, [s̺əteːkə]

Numeral[edit]

ސަތޭކަ (satēka)

  1. hundred
